Backup Simples de tabela MYSQL
Publicado por Fábio J. Bonatto 03/05/2005
[ Hits: 6.459 ]
Este Script mostra, de forma simples, como fazer um backup de tabela no Mysql e enviar o mesmo por email para o Administrador, utilizando o sendmail (adotando q já esteja configurado).
#!/bin/sh MAILFILE=/tmp/mailtemp HEADER=/tmp/header data=`date` clear echo "Fazendo o dump do banco de dados..." #Faz o backup via mysqldump mysqldump -h host_da_maquina -u usuario nome_tabela > tabela.sql echo "Compactando o banco" zip nome_tabela.zip tabela.sql rm tabela.sql #apagamos para não ocupar espaço echo "" echo "Enviando arquivo via email...." echo "To: admin@dominio.com.br" >> $HEADER echo "Subject: Backup da base de dados: SISTEMA" >> $HEADER echo "" >> $HEADER echo "" >> $HEADER echo "Backup da base de dados do sistema xxxx realizado em: $data" >> $HEADER echo "" >> $HEADER cat $HEADER > $MAILFILE uuencode nome_tabela nome_tabela>> $MAILFILE #Anexa arquivo cat $MAILFILE | /usr/sbin/sendmail -t -v # o cat, envia o email com o cabeçalho e com o anexo echo "" echo "Limpando os arquivos temporarios...." rm sistema.zip rm $MAILFILE rm $HEADER echo ""
Simulado para provas LPI nível 1
Automatizando backups no Samba
Nenhum comentário foi encontrado.
Atenção a quem posta conteúdo de dicas, scripts e tal (2)
Criando um gateway de internet com o Debian
Configuração básica do Conky para mostrar informações sobre a sua máquina no Desktop
Aprenda a criar músicas com Inteligência Artificial usando Suno AI
Entendendo o que é URI, URL, URN e conhecendo as diferenças entre POST e GET
Ativando o Modo Noturno via Linha de Comando no GNOME/Wayland
Preparando pendrive com GNU/Linux [Corretamente!]
Instalando Google Chrome no Fedora 40
Habilitando a importação de senhas no Firefox
Como corrigir o erro do VirtualBox travar a máquina virtual em tela cheia
Altera pacote .pkg.tar do Arch Linux (19)
Navegadores com linhas na tela (6)
Pi Network.... alguém minera? (5)